FRP Platform Tread
Overview
Fiberglass grating tread plates, also known as FRP grating, are composite panels made by combining fiberglass strands with a thermosetting resin matrix. This creates a strong, lightweight material that outperforms traditional steel or aluminum grating in corrosive environments. The open grid design allows for drainage, ventilation, and light transmission while providing a secure walking surface. These tread plates are manufactured through molding or pultrusion processes, resulting in products with consistent quality and mechanical properties. They are available in various mesh sizes, thicknesses, and surface treatments to meet different industrial requirements. The material's inherent corrosion resistance makes it particularly valuable in chemical processing plants, marine applications, and wastewater treatment facilities.
Structure and Working Principle
Fiberglass grating consists of parallel and cross-roving fiberglass strands embedded in resin, forming a rigid grid pattern. The longitudinal strands bear most of the load, while the cross strands provide stability and distribute weight. The resin matrix binds the fibers together and protects them from environmental damage. The working principle relies on the composite's ability to combine the tensile strength of fiberglass with the chemical resistance of the resin. Unlike metal gratings that corrode, FRP maintains its structural integrity when exposed to chemicals, moisture, and UV radiation. The panels can be manufactured with different surface textures (such as grit-coated or serrated) to enhance slip resistance in wet or oily conditions.
Key Features
The most notable feature of fiberglass grating tread plates is their exceptional corrosion resistance. They withstand exposure to acids, alkalis, solvents, and saltwater without degradation, making them ideal for chemical plants and marine environments. Their non-conductive properties provide electrical safety in power plants and utility areas. Despite being lightweight (about 1/4 the weight of steel), FRP grating offers impressive strength-to-weight ratio. It's easy to handle and install, reducing labor costs. The material is also fire-retardant and emits low smoke when exposed to flame. Maintenance requirements are minimal as FRP doesn't rust, rot, or require painting, leading to long-term cost savings.
Application Areas
Fiberglass grating tread plates are extensively used in chemical processing plants for walkways, platforms, and stair treads where metal would quickly corrode. Offshore oil platforms and marine structures benefit from their saltwater resistance. Water treatment facilities use them for catwalks and filter floors exposed to corrosive chemicals. Other common applications include food processing plants (where sanitation is critical), electrical substations (for non-conductive safety), and cooling towers. The grating is also popular in architectural applications like pedestrian bridges and rooftop walkways where lightweight durability is needed. In industrial settings, they serve as safety flooring around machinery and equipment.
Maintenance and Precautions
FRP grating requires minimal maintenance compared to metal alternatives. Periodic cleaning with mild detergent and water is usually sufficient to maintain appearance and slip resistance. Avoid using abrasive cleaners or steel brushes that could damage the surface texture. For installation and use precautions, ensure proper support spacing according to load requirements. While FRP is strong, excessive unsupported spans can lead to deflection. Use appropriate fasteners (typically stainless steel or FRP) to prevent galvanic corrosion. In high-traffic areas, consider thicker panels or closer support spacing. Always follow manufacturer guidelines for specific chemical exposure limits and load ratings.
B2B Procurement Guide
When sourcing fiberglass grating tread plates, first determine the required load capacity (measured in pounds per square foot) based on anticipated foot traffic and equipment weights. Standard thicknesses range from 1" to 2", with custom options available. Consider panel size requirements to minimize cutting and waste during installation. For chemical environments, verify resin compatibility with expected exposures. Isophthalic polyester resin suits most applications, while vinyl ester offers superior acid resistance. Request material certifications and test reports for quality assurance. Lead times can vary, so plan purchases accordingly, especially for custom configurations. Establish relationships with manufacturers who can provide technical support and consistent supply.
